Which companies sponsor visas for civil project managers in California?
Large engineering and construction firms with established sponsorship programs are the most active in California. AECOM, Jacobs, WSP, HDR, and Parsons have sponsored civil project managers through the H-1B visa program in previous years based on DOL disclosure data. Public agency contractors working on Caltrans, LA Metro, and SFPUC projects also generate consistent demand for internationally qualified civil project management professionals.
Which visa types are most common for civil project manager roles in California?
The H-1B is the most common visa for civil project managers in California, as the role typically qualifies as a specialty occupation requiring at least a bachelor's degree in civil engineering or a closely related field. Candidates with Canadian or Mexican citizenship may qualify for TN visa status under the USMCA treaty. Those with extraordinary ability or a national interest waiver petition may pursue O-1 visa or EB-2 NIW pathways, though these require stronger documentation.

Which cities in California have the most civil project manager sponsorship jobs?
Los Angeles and the surrounding metro area generate the highest volume of civil project manager roles, driven by LA Metro rail expansions, port infrastructure, and highway programs. San Francisco and San Jose follow closely, supported by BART, Caltrain modernization, and water infrastructure work. San Diego has consistent demand tied to military and municipal projects, while Sacramento sees activity from state transportation and flood control programs.
Are there any California-specific considerations for civil project managers seeking visa sponsorship?
California's prevailing wage requirements under state law can exceed federal DOL prevailing wage levels, which affects how employers structure H-1B Labor Condition Applications for roles in this state. California also has an unusually active infrastructure pipeline funded by state bonds and federal programs, creating longer-term project demand. Universities like UC Berkeley, Cal Poly, and USC produce strong civil engineering graduate pipelines, so international candidates often compete alongside OPT and CPT holders already in the state.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ored civil project manager jobs in California?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
